Amazon Phone being built by Foxconn, coming in Q2, 2013: Report

Amazon Phone is back in news and this time a report coming out of Taiwan is suggesting that Amazon Phone is being built by Foxconn, which also makes iPhone, iPad for Apple.  According to Taiwan Economic News, the smartphone is expected to be launched in Q2/Q3 of the next year.

The publication claims that the smartphone price will be $100-$200 and Foxconn will reportedly ship 5 million units of the phone in the year.

The report also adds that Amazon is also working on a new version of Kindle Fire, which will be released around the same time as Amazon Phone and is being supplied by Quanta Computer and Compal Electronics.

Amazon Phone or Kindle Phone has regularly appeared in news, but there is hardly any concrete information about the device, which is likely to run on custom version of Android.
